One of the most awe-inspiring examples of bee mathematics can be found in their construction of honeycombs. Bees build hexagonal cells with remarkable precision, ensuring that the walls are of uniform thickness and the angles between them are precisely 120 degrees. This hexagonal pattern allows bees to maximize storage space while minimizing the amount of wax used in construction. Hexagons are mathematically proven to be the most efficient shape for enclosing a given area, making bees' honeycomb design a testament to their remarkable efficiency and mathematical instinct.

Bees also exhibit extraordinary navigational skills, relying on intricate geometric calculations to communicate directions to food sources. They perform a "waggle dance" in the hive, which conveys information about the direction and distance of nectar-rich flowers. The duration and angle of the dance correlate with the distance and direction relative to the sun, respectively. Through this dance, bees communicate complex mathematical information to guide their fellow hive members to optimal food sources.
